A preliminary study on identification of clay minerals in soils with reference to reflectance spectra
XU Bin-Bin, LI De-Cheng and SHI Xiao-Ri
Institute of Soil Science, Academia Sinica, P. O. Box 821, Nanjing 210008 (China)
ABSTRACT
      The characteristics of the reflectance spectra of clay minerals and their influences on the reflectance spectra of soils are dealt with in the paper. The results showed that dominant clay minerals in soils could be distinguished in light of the spectral-form parameters of the reflectance spectra of soils, thus making it possible to develop a quick method to determine clay minerals by means of reflectance spectra of soils in the lab. and providing a theoretic basis for remote sensing of clay minerals in soils with a high resolution imaging spectrometer.
